logo

Output d08d2b96625299c2101349e575d9d5f9d8ae99299c3159bd227e98a443918616:3

value
17860000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 925abd66bb8c38788f0fc1e49f64ace953b038f2 OP_EQUAL
address
3F2sHGPpUhUjXDffjkzRSVrB6GnVkY2ji4
transaction
d08d2b96625299c2101349e575d9d5f9d8ae99299c3159bd227e98a443918616